I have about 12 miles on a brand new set of gears (4.88) and a detroit locker. D30 open/8.8 locked.
The problem is, I'm getting a ticking at acceleration ONLY and it speeds up to a harmonic grind the more I accelerate. It does NOT do it when I let off the gas and as far as I can tell it does not do it in reverse. It's constant going STRAIT and when cornering, no difference.
I first thougt that it might be a t-case problem (chain) but I think it's coming from the rear locker. Other thoughts include a cv joint or something in the t-case.
Anybody have experience with this sort of thing? I plan to give the shop a call that did the install.
It's not real loud (like a bad pinion) but is loud enough to bother me.
